Title:
ELECTRONIC DEVICE AND AIR-CONDITIONING CONTROL METHOD THEREFOR

Abstract:
The present invention relates to techniques for a sensor network, machine to machine (M2M), machine type communication (MTC), and Internet of things (IoT). The present invention can be utilized in the technique-based intelligent services (smart home, smart building, smart city, smart car or connected car, healthcare, digital education, retail business, security and safety-related service and the like). The air-conditioning control method for the electronic device, according to one embodiment of the present invention, comprises the steps of: determining the rate of temperature change on the basis of changes in the temperature measured for the first time; acquiring first density information on the basis of the determined rate of temperature change and the location information on the location at which the temperature change is measured; and controlling air-conditioning according to the first density information.
